Lumifi has purchased Castra Managed Services to "expand its capabilities and reinforce its commitment to the Gartner (SOC) Visibility triad," the company announced.The news comes after Lumifi in September 2023 said it planned to complete an acquisition "in the next 45 days."Financial terms of the Castra transaction were not disclosed.This is technology M&A deal number 275 that MSSP Alert and sister site ChannelE2E have covered so far in 2023. Lumifi, founded in 2022, is based in Scottsdale, Arizona. The company has 64 employees listed on LinkedIn. Lumifi's areas of expertise include managed detection and response (MDR), security orchestration, automation and response (SOAR) and incident response.Castra, founded in 2012, is based in Durham, North Carolina. The company has 18 employees listed on LinkedIn. Castra's areas of expertise include MDR, security information and event management (SIEM) and threat intelligence.Endpoint detection and response (EDR) Network detection and response (NDR) SIEM Furthermore, Lumifi and Castra will provide their joint customers with an SOC that utilizes Lumifi's ShieldVision SOAR platform and Castra's MDR services, the companies noted. These customers can use ShieldVision to hunt for, detect and respond to threats.Meanwhile, Castra provides expertise in Exabeam SIEM and ensures that organizations of all sizes and budgets can use its MDR services in conjunction with ShieldVision to secure their infrastructure.
